Azure Migrate
- Azure माइग्रेट: शुरुआती गाइड
Azure माइग्रेट एक ऐसा उपकरण है जो आपको अपने ऑन-प्रिमाइसेस, क्लाउड या अन्य वातावरणों से Azure में अपने सर्वर, डेटाबेस और एप्लिकेशन को माइग्रेट करने में मदद करता है। यह एक व्यापक सेवा है जो मूल्यांकन, खोज, माइग्रेशन और अनुकूलन सहित माइग्रेशन प्रक्रिया के सभी चरणों का समर्थन करती है। यह लेख शुरुआती लोगों के लिए Azure माइग्रेट का विस्तृत अवलोकन प्रदान करता है, जिसमें इसकी मुख्य विशेषताएं, लाभ और उपयोग के मामले शामिल हैं।
Azure माइग्रेट क्या है?
Azure माइग्रेट एक सुरक्षित और विश्वसनीय सेवा है जो आपको अपने मौजूदा वर्कलोड को Azure में ले जाने में मदद करती है। यह आपको विभिन्न प्रकार के माइग्रेशन विकल्प प्रदान करता है, जिनमें रीहोस्टिंग (लिफ्ट एंड शिफ्ट), रीफैक्टरिंग, रीप्लेटफॉर्मिंग और रीपरचेसिंग शामिल हैं। Azure माइग्रेट आपको माइग्रेशन प्रक्रिया को स्वचालित करने, डाउनटाइम को कम करने और लागत को अनुकूलित करने में भी मदद कर सकता है। क्लाउड माइग्रेशन रणनीतियों को समझना Azure माइग्रेट का उपयोग करने से पहले महत्वपूर्ण है।
Azure माइग्रेट के लाभ
Azure माइग्रेट का उपयोग करने के कई लाभ हैं, जिनमें शामिल हैं:
- **लागत बचत:** Azure माइग्रेट आपको अपने ऑन-प्रिमाइसेस इन्फ्रास्ट्रक्चर की लागत को कम करने में मदद कर सकता है। कुल स्वामित्व लागत (TCO) को कम करने के लिए Azure माइग्रेट एक प्रभावी उपकरण है।
- **स्केलेबिलिटी और लचीलापन:** Azure आपको अपनी आवश्यकताओं के अनुसार अपने संसाधनों को स्केल करने की क्षमता प्रदान करता है। स्केलेबिलिटी Azure माइग्रेट के मुख्य लाभों में से एक है।
- **विश्वसनीयता और उपलब्धता:** Azure एक अत्यधिक विश्वसनीय और उपलब्ध प्लेटफॉर्म है। उच्च उपलब्धता सुनिश्चित करने के लिए Azure माइग्रेट का उपयोग किया जा सकता है।
- **सुरक्षा:** Azure आपके डेटा और एप्लिकेशन को सुरक्षित रखने के लिए कई सुरक्षा सुविधाएँ प्रदान करता है। Azure सुरक्षा Azure माइग्रेट के साथ एकीकृत है।
- **नवाचार:** Azure आपको नवीनतम तकनीकों और सेवाओं का उपयोग करने की क्षमता प्रदान करता है। Azure नवाचार माइग्रेशन के बाद नए अवसरों को खोल सकता है।
Azure माइग्रेट के घटक
Azure माइग्रेट में कई घटक शामिल हैं, जिनमें शामिल हैं:
- **Azure माइग्रेट सर्वर:** यह घटक आपको अपने ऑन-प्रिमाइसेस सर्वर को Azure में माइग्रेट करने में मदद करता है। Azure माइग्रेट सर्वर वर्चुअल मशीनों (VMs) के माइग्रेशन का समर्थन करता है।
- **Azure माइग्रेट डेटाबेस:** यह घटक आपको अपने डेटाबेस को Azure में माइग्रेट करने में मदद करता है। Azure माइग्रेट डेटाबेस SQL Server, Oracle, MySQL और PostgreSQL जैसे विभिन्न प्रकार के डेटाबेस का समर्थन करता है।
- **Azure माइग्रेट वेब ऐप:** यह घटक आपको अपने वेब एप्लिकेशन को Azure में माइग्रेट करने में मदद करता है। Azure वेब ऐप माइग्रेशन ASP.NET, PHP और Java जैसे विभिन्न प्रकार के वेब एप्लिकेशन का समर्थन करता है।
- **Azure माइग्रेट डिस्कवरी:** यह घटक आपके ऑन-प्रिमाइसेस वातावरण में सर्वर और एप्लिकेशन की खोज करता है। Azure डिस्कवरी माइग्रेशन योजना के लिए महत्वपूर्ण जानकारी प्रदान करता है।
- **Azure माइग्रेट असेसमेंट:** यह घटक आपके ऑन-प्रिमाइसेस वर्कलोड का मूल्यांकन करता है और Azure में माइग्रेशन के लिए सिफारिशें प्रदान करता है। Azure असेसमेंट अनुकूलन और संभावित मुद्दों की पहचान करने में मदद करता है।
Azure माइग्रेट का उपयोग कैसे करें
Azure माइग्रेट का उपयोग करने के लिए, आपको निम्नलिखित चरणों का पालन करना होगा:
1. **खोज और मूल्यांकन:** अपने ऑन-प्रिमाइसेस वातावरण में सर्वर और एप्लिकेशन की खोज करें और उनका मूल्यांकन करें। माइग्रेशन प्लानिंग के लिए यह चरण महत्वपूर्ण है। तकनीकी विश्लेषण और वॉल्यूम विश्लेषण आपके ऑन-प्रिमाइसेस वातावरण को समझने में मदद करते हैं। 2. **माइग्रेशन रणनीति का चयन:** अपनी आवश्यकताओं के अनुसार माइग्रेशन रणनीति का चयन करें। रीहोस्टिंग (लिफ्ट एंड शिफ्ट) सबसे सरल रणनीति है, जबकि रीफैक्टरिंग और रीप्लेटफॉर्मिंग अधिक जटिल हैं। 3. **माइग्रेशन टूल का चयन:** अपनी माइग्रेशन रणनीति और वर्कलोड के प्रकार के आधार पर माइग्रेशन टूल का चयन करें। Azure Site Recovery और Azure Database Migration Service सामान्य उपकरण हैं। 4. **माइग्रेशन प्रक्रिया को कॉन्फ़िगर करें:** माइग्रेशन प्रक्रिया को कॉन्फ़िगर करें, जिसमें लक्ष्य Azure क्षेत्र, वर्चुअल नेटवर्क और स्टोरेज खाते शामिल हैं। नेटवर्किंग और स्टोरेज कॉन्फ़िगरेशन महत्वपूर्ण हैं। 5. **माइग्रेशन प्रक्रिया शुरू करें:** माइग्रेशन प्रक्रिया शुरू करें और प्रगति की निगरानी करें। माइग्रेशन मॉनिटरिंग किसी भी समस्या को जल्दी पहचानने में मदद करता है। 6. **माइग्रेशन के बाद परीक्षण और अनुकूलन:** माइग्रेशन के बाद अपने एप्लिकेशन और डेटा का परीक्षण करें और प्रदर्शन को अनुकूलित करें। प्रदर्शन अनुकूलन Azure में आपके वर्कलोड की दक्षता सुनिश्चित करता है।
माइग्रेशन रणनीतियाँ
विभिन्न प्रकार की माइग्रेशन रणनीतियाँ हैं जिनका उपयोग आप Azure माइग्रेट के साथ कर सकते हैं:
- **रीहोस्टिंग (लिफ्ट एंड शिफ्ट):** यह सबसे सरल रणनीति है, जिसमें आप अपने ऑन-प्रिमाइसेस सर्वर और एप्लिकेशन को बिना किसी बदलाव के Azure में ले जाते हैं। रीहोस्टिंग लाभ और रीहोस्टिंग सीमाएँ को समझना महत्वपूर्ण है।
- **रीफैक्टरिंग:** इस रणनीति में आप अपने एप्लिकेशन कोड को Azure के लिए अनुकूलित करते हैं। रीफैक्टरिंग तकनीक और रीफैक्टरिंग लागत पर विचार करना चाहिए।
- **रीप्लेटफॉर्मिंग:** इस रणनीति में आप अपने एप्लिकेशन को Azure के लिए एक अलग प्लेटफॉर्म पर ले जाते हैं। रीप्लेटफॉर्मिंग विकल्प और रीप्लेटफॉर्मिंग जोखिम का मूल्यांकन करना चाहिए।
- **रीपरचेसिंग:** इस रणनीति में आप अपने ऑन-प्रिमाइसेस एप्लिकेशन को Azure में एक SaaS समाधान से बदलते हैं। SaaS समाधान और रीपरचेसिंग लाभ पर विचार करना चाहिए।
Azure माइग्रेट के लिए सर्वोत्तम अभ्यास
Azure माइग्रेट का उपयोग करते समय कुछ सर्वोत्तम अभ्यास हैं जिनका पालन करना चाहिए:
- **एक स्पष्ट माइग्रेशन योजना बनाएं:** माइग्रेशन शुरू करने से पहले एक स्पष्ट माइग्रेशन योजना बनाएं। माइग्रेशन योजना टेम्पलेट और माइग्रेशन चेकलिस्ट उपयोगी हो सकते हैं।
- **अपने एप्लिकेशन और डेटा का बैकअप लें:** माइग्रेशन शुरू करने से पहले अपने एप्लिकेशन और डेटा का बैकअप लें। डेटा बैकअप रणनीति और डेटा रिकवरी प्रक्रिया महत्वपूर्ण हैं।
- **अपने माइग्रेशन का परीक्षण करें:** माइग्रेशन शुरू करने से पहले अपने माइग्रेशन का परीक्षण करें। टेस्ट माइग्रेशन प्रक्रिया और टेस्ट परिणाम विश्लेषण आवश्यक हैं।
- **माइग्रेशन के बाद अपने एप्लिकेशन और डेटा की निगरानी करें:** माइग्रेशन के बाद अपने एप्लिकेशन और डेटा की निगरानी करें। माइग्रेशन के बाद निगरानी और समस्या निवारण के लिए तैयार रहें।
- **सुरक्षा पर ध्यान दें:** सुनिश्चित करें कि आपका माइग्रेशन सुरक्षित है। सुरक्षा सर्वोत्तम अभ्यास और अनुपालन आवश्यकताएँ का पालन करें।
Azure माइग्रेट के उपयोग के मामले
Azure माइग्रेट का उपयोग विभिन्न प्रकार के उपयोग के मामलों के लिए किया जा सकता है, जिनमें शामिल हैं:
- **डेटा सेंटर माइग्रेशन:** अपने ऑन-प्रिमाइसेस डेटा सेंटर को Azure में माइग्रेट करें। डेटा सेंटर माइग्रेशन रणनीति और डेटा सेंटर माइग्रेशन लागत पर विचार करें।
- **एप्लिकेशन माइग्रेशन:** अपने ऑन-प्रिमाइसेस एप्लिकेशन को Azure में माइग्रेट करें। एप्लिकेशन माइग्रेशन दृष्टिकोण और एप्लिकेशन माइग्रेशन चुनौतियाँ को समझें।
- **डेटाबेस माइग्रेशन:** अपने ऑन-प्रिमाइसेस डेटाबेस को Azure में माइग्रेट करें। डेटाबेस माइग्रेशन उपकरण और डेटाबेस माइग्रेशन सर्वोत्तम अभ्यास का उपयोग करें।
- **डिजास्टर रिकवरी:** Azure का उपयोग अपने ऑन-प्रिमाइसेस वर्कलोड के लिए डिजास्टर रिकवरी साइट के रूप में करें। डिजास्टर रिकवरी योजना और डिजास्टर रिकवरी परीक्षण महत्वपूर्ण हैं।
- **डेवलपमेंट और टेस्टिंग:** Azure का उपयोग अपने डेवलपमेंट और टेस्टिंग वातावरण के लिए करें। DevOps और CI/CD Azure के साथ अच्छी तरह से एकीकृत हैं।
आगे की पढ़ाई
Azure माइग्रेट के बारे में अधिक जानने के लिए, निम्नलिखित संसाधनों का उपयोग करें:
- Azure माइग्रेट दस्तावेज़ीकरण
- Azure माइग्रेट ट्यूटोरियल
- Azure माइग्रेट ब्लॉग
- Azure माइग्रेट समुदाय
- माइक्रोसॉफ्ट लर्न
निष्कर्ष
Azure माइग्रेट एक शक्तिशाली उपकरण है जो आपको अपने ऑन-प्रिमाइसेस वर्कलोड को Azure में माइग्रेट करने में मदद कर सकता है। यह आपको लागत बचत, स्केलेबिलिटी, विश्वसनीयता, सुरक्षा और नवाचार जैसे कई लाभ प्रदान करता है। Azure माइग्रेट का उपयोग करने से पहले, अपनी आवश्यकताओं के अनुसार एक स्पष्ट माइग्रेशन योजना बनाएं और सर्वोत्तम प्रथाओं का पालन करें। Azure माइग्रेट सफलता की कहानियाँ आपको प्रेरणा दे सकती हैं। लागत प्रबंधन और संसाधन अनुकूलन माइग्रेशन के बाद महत्वपूर्ण हैं। स्वचालन और स्क्रिप्टिंग माइग्रेशन प्रक्रिया को सरल बना सकते हैं। Azure Policy और Azure Resource Manager माइग्रेशन को नियंत्रित और प्रबंधित करने में मदद करते हैं। Azure Monitor और Azure Log Analytics माइग्रेशन के बाद प्रदर्शन की निगरानी के लिए महत्वपूर्ण हैं। Azure Advisor अनुकूलन के लिए सिफारिशें प्रदान करता है।
अभी ट्रेडिंग शुरू करें
IQ Option पर रजिस्टर करें (न्यूनतम जमा $10) Pocket Option में खाता खोलें (न्यूनतम जमा $5)
हमारे समुदाय में शामिल हों
हमारे Telegram चैनल @strategybin से जुड़ें और प्राप्त करें: ✓ दैनिक ट्रेडिंग सिग्नल ✓ विशेष रणनीति विश्लेषण ✓ बाजार की प्रवृत्ति पर अलर्ट ✓ शुरुआती के लिए शिक्षण सामग्री